At last-an effective teaching manual to help nurse educators! From
Nurse to Educator: Creating Effective Learning Experiences for Adults
by Lyla Berry, EdD, MA, RN highlights the skills nurses need in order
to be effective educators.
Nursing professionals involved with teaching need information concerning
adult teaching and learning principles, as well as how to use those principles
in planning, implementing, and presenting effective adult-learning experiences.
This book gives nurse educators the simple teaching tools needed to better
prepare a new generation of caregivers.
